Which is the factorial of the binomial equation?
The probability of “success” or occurrence of the outcome of interest is indicated by “p”. The binomial equation also uses factorials. In mathematics, the factorial of a non-negative integer k is denoted by k!, which is the product of all positive integers less than or equal to k. For example, 4! = 4 x 3 x 2 x 1 = 24, 2! = 2 x 1 = 2, 1!=1.
How to calculate the probability of an outcome?
First, we let “n” denote the number of observations or the number of times the process is repeated, and “x” denotes the number of “successes” or events of interest occurring during “n” observations. The probability of “success” or occurrence of the outcome of interest is indicated by “p”.
